    First Report of Dermestes frischii Kugelann (Coleoptera: Dermestidae) on a Human Corpse, South of Iran

    The necrophagous species of beetles provide useful complementary data to estimate the post-mortem interval in forensic cases. We report, for the first time, Dermestes frischii Kugelann, 1792 larvae from a mummified human body covered with bushes and located in a canal in Sarvestan district, Fars province, south of Iran. The human corpse was a 63 year old male. The time of death was estimated to have been 23 days prior to the finding of the body based on the police investigations and confessions of a suspect. This beetle can be helpful to estimate the time of death in the future

    Saprinus planiusculus (Motschulsky‚ 1849) (Coleoptera: Histeridae), a beetle species of forensic importance in Khuzetan Province, Iran

    Abstract Background Medico legal forensic entomology is the science and study of cadaveric arthropods related to criminal investigations. The study of beetles is particularly important in forensic cases. This can be important in determining the time of death and also obtain qualitative information about the location of the crime. The aim of this study was to introduce the Saprinus planiusculus on a rat carrion as a beetle species of forensic importance in Khuzestan province. Methods This study was carried out using a laboratory bred rat (Wistar rat) as a model for human decomposition. The rat was killed by contusion and placed in a location adjacent to the Karun River. Observations and collections of beetles were made daily during May to July 2015. Results Decomposition time for rat carrion lasted 38 days and S. planiusculus was seen in the fresh to post decay stages of body decomposition and the largest number of this species caught in the decay stage. Conclusion The species of beetle found in this case could be used in forensic investigations, particularly during the warm season in the future

    First Forensic Record of Blowfly, Calliphora vicina, Larvae on an Indoor Human Corpse in Winter, South of Iran

    A new report of necrophagous blowfly, Calliphora vicina (Diptera: Calliphoridae), larvae from a human corpse found in the bathroom of a house during winter in Shiraz, Fars province, south of Iran, is presented. An autopsy revealed that the cadaver was an 83-year-old solitary-living Iranian female having a stroke during bath. The minimum time elapsed since death was estimated to have been less than 5 days prior to the discovery of the bloated cadaver at defined ambient temperatures. As such, this synanthropic species was associated with the early wave of colonizing cadaver-feeding insects that were found on a corpse after death. This is the first corroborated evidence of a forensic entomology case involving this bluebottle blowfly species of insect in south of Iran and this species can be helpful in the future to support the estimation on the time elapsed since death in this region

    Preliminary Data on Life Cycle of Creophilus maxillosus Linnaeus (Coleoptera: Staphylinidae) and New Report of this Species on a Human Corpse, South of Iran

    Beetles (Coleoptera) have been recognized as significant entomological evidence in the forensic entomology field in estimating the postmortem interval (PMI). We report on the colonization of an adult human corpse by three beetle species in Sadra district, Fars province, south of Iran. The adults of Creophilus maxillosus, Dermestes frischii and Hister sp were all collected from the victim’s body which had been wrapped in a sack. For the life cycle study, Creophilus maxillosus (Coleoptera: Staphylinidae) adult beetles were allowed to feed, mate and oviposit in rearing chamber (11 × 9 cm) at 23 ± 1°C. Development rates from the instance mates placed together to the emergence of adults was 41 days. Information from this study can be helpful in forensic entomology study
